Power and Performance

This team short is made for soccer and feels incredible.

Lightly textured fabric with durability, stretch, and no excess weight. Signature Moisture Transport System wicks sweat away from the body, keeping you cooler and drier. Smooth flatlock seams allow a full range of motion without chafing.

Lightweight short with moisture control. Comfort stretch construction. 7.5" inseam (size medium). 100% polyester.

The mascot for the 1970 FIFA World Cup in Mexico was a boy character named Jaunito. The most prolific goal-scorer in the North American Soccer League was Italian Giorgio Chinaglia of the New York Cosmos: 242 goals in 254 games. U.S. Men’s National Team played their first ever game in 1916 vs. Sweden in Stockholm. In the early years of of the game, American soccer was dominated by teams from New England, particularly Fall River, New Bedford and Pawtucket. Australia beat American Samoa 31-0 in a 2001 World Cup Qualifying match.
